The Museum of Outdoor Arts (MOA), established in 1981, is dedicated to integrating art into everyday life through the strategic placement of site-specific sculptures across the Denver metro area. Its diverse collection can be found in public spaces, including commercial office parks, city parks, and botanic gardens, effectively transforming these locations into a museum without walls.
Located primarily in Marjorie Park, MOA showcases a variety of exhibitions, events, and programs that encourage community engagement with art. Recognized as a top destination for art by 5280 Magazine, the museum continues to foster creativity and cultural appreciation through artistic experiences and immersive installations.
